AMPA Mini Pig Zoning Packet Mini Pig Zoning Requirements: Pigs still fall into the legal description of livestock according to the USDA and the majority of city governments.It is imperative to check with city government regulations before bringing a pig into your home as a pet.Pennsylvania State Dog Law (Chapter 21 of Title 7) requires all dogs three (3) months and older to be licensed every calendar year, in the county they reside. 2024 Dog Licenses Annual Dog Licenses. Annual Dog License fee is $8.70 per license. Individuals who are 65 and older, or have certain disabilities pay a discounted rate of $6.70 per license.Exotic Fish & Pets, Reading, Pennsylvania. 3,678 likes · 41 talking about this · 162 were here. Alabama. Connecticut. Delaware.Historically, bobcats are native to Pennsylvania. However, in the mid-1800s, these wild cats were considered vermin, and various bounties were placed which led to a drastic rise in bobcat killings. As there was not much change in the surroundings, bounties were dropped in 1938. However, as they remained unprotected there was unregulated …Hawaii has the most restrictive pet laws. Little Brown Bat (Myotis lucifugus) The little brown, is found statewide. Length, including the tail, is 3.1 to 3.7 inches; wingspread, 8.6 to 10.5 inches; weight ranges from 0.25 to 0.35 ounces, and is greatest just before hibernation. Females are slightly larger than males.

The Hunting and Trapping Digest serves as a great resource when it comes to questions about hunting seasons ...Dogs imported into PA kennels must be isolated for at least 14 days. Fines for unlicensed dogs will range from $100 to $500, plus court costs. The criminal penalties for all other violations of the dog law have increased to $500 to $1,000 for summary offenses and $1,000 to $5,000 for misdemeanor offenses plus court costs.Oregon. Vermont. Image Credit: Mike Wilhelm, Shutterstock.With a large number of cats and dogs being killed or becoming severely sickened by the recent “tainted” pet food scare, many pet owners are wondering what remedies and/or damages are available to them. Unfortunately, in Pennsylvania, pets are considered personal property. 3 P.S. 459-601(a). Because pets are only considered personal property, the damages a pet owner can recover against a ...
